The built-in ntpd(8) is not the same as the net/ntp
package.
Packages are third party applications that are
not included with OpenBSD, but have been ported to OpenBSD.
If you are using the built-in ntpd, the daemon is running /usr/sbin/ntpd. If you are using the third party net/ntp package, the daemon is running /usr/
local/sbin/ntpd.
